TCS/BM/189/SE/2024-22 dated January 12, ... “RESOLVED FURTHER THAT the Company may buyback Equity Shares from all the existing Members holding Equity Shares of the Company on a proportionate basis, ... ipad no headphone jackWebb25 jan. 2024 · As per SEBI buyback regulations and Companies Act, buyback of shares should be authorised by passing a special resolution at the general meeting of a company. Further, the maximum limit of buy-back should be 25% or less of aggregate of paid-up capital and free reserves. ipad not holding charge
